Biblical Meaning of Deity
In simple terms, deity means God or a divine being. In the Bible, it refers to the one true God, the Creator of heaven and earth.
The Bible clearly shows that God is not like humans. He is holy, eternal, and all-powerful.
God as the One True Deity
The Bible teaches that there is only one true God:
- “I am the Lord, and there is no other.” Isaiah 45:5
- “Hear, O Israel: The Lord our God, the Lord is one.” Deuteronomy 6:4
These verses remind us that God is the only true deity, above all things.
God’s Divine Nature
God’s deity means He is:
- All-powerful (Almighty)
- All-knowing (Omniscient)
- Always present (Omnipresent)
In Colossians 2:9, it says:
“For in Christ all the fullness of the Deity lives in bodily form.”
This shows that even Jesus carries the full nature of God, revealing His love and truth to the world.

Warning Meaning
The Bible also warns against false deities or idols:
- “You shall have no other gods before me.” Exodus 20:3
This reminds us to stay focused on the true God, not on things that take His place in our hearts.
